Runbook — Varnley Awards Night, trophy engraving leg. Driver collects twelve engraved trophies from Calloway Engravers in Dunmere no earlier than 14:00, once final proofing is signed off. Each trophy travels in its foam sleeve, boxes upright, no stacking above two. Deliver to the Larchfield Hall stage door and obtain a signed count from the events lead. The courier hand-over instruction is given immediately below.

handover note for yagef-bagep: the drudor pelius courier leaves the kasdor zorvan norir ledger at gate 8016 under passcode 755406

## Configuration

The TideGlance widget polls the Marrow Bay harbor service every ten minutes and caches results locally. Set TIDE_REFRESH_INTERVAL and TIDE_STATION_CODE in `.env` before deploying; defaults target the Pellen Cove station. If the upstream feed stalls, the widget serves stale data for up to six hours before showing a warning banner. Authentication against the harbor API requires a token, which you add on the next line.

vault entry, yahif-yajep: COURIER_KEY29=b802bdf8034096b65a51c6ba5abe2

**Q: How do I recover the signing key for the snipsq release pipeline?**

A: snipsq batch-resizes via `snipsq run --profile thumbs`. Release builds are signed from the Tovermill vault. If the vault token expires, re-initialize with the recovery passphrase held by the maintainer on rotation. For convenience, it is recorded directly below.

vault phrase of yagag-kadup = belael-druius-rusax-kelox